

Jo Ann Albertson was born in Parshall, Colorado, on July 4th, 1934, to Vinton and Virginia Milner. Jo Ann passed away peacefully at The Fountains of Hilltop in Grand Junction, CO on April 11th, 2026. She was 91 years old. She spent her early years on a ranch along Williams Fork River, south of Parshall, where the rhythms of rural life shaped her strength and kindness.
She graduated from Kremmling Union High School and went on to attend Colorado A&M, where she met Frank Albertson, the love of her life. They were married on December 27, 1953. After Frank’s graduation, they built a life together across three cherished homes: the family ranch in Burns, Colorado; a ranch in Nine Mile Canyon, Utah; and later, a farm near Fruita, where they settled and raised their family.
For nearly 40 years, she served as a school bus driver for District 51, transporting children in the Fruita and Appleton areas with a warm smile. Above all, she was devoted to her family. She and Frank spent summers working side by side on the Ranch, building a life rooted in hard work, faith, and the joy of being together.
She is survived by her three children: Kim (Debbie) Albertson, Teri Lynch (Larry), and Jelaine Wahlert (Kevin); six grandchildren; and ten great-gr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her parents, her beloved husband Frank, brothers William and Robert Milner, granddaughter Ryann Wahlert, and great-grandson Jacob Kujala.
